Transaction 4893880f7705fe0421a40b0a23c9deafa2e762b509a41158200100c8e1750f5f
1 Input
2 Outputs
- 4893880f7705fe0421a40b0a23c9deafa2e762b509a41158200100c8e1750f5f:0
- 4893880f7705fe0421a40b0a23c9deafa2e762b509a41158200100c8e1750f5f:1
value 648127
address 3Ed7XMS98ex58z3Gg22Q95HnxRTerqiT6z
value 70106
address 1H4GRPJ4YYNun5ygMsTACawkf55HdJFUyC